KBI Biopharma Names David Stewart Site Head of Durham Manufacturing Facility

Expertise includes project execution, product supply, operational readiness, process engineering, product technical transfer, and lab operations.

KBI Biopharma, Inc. (KBI), a JSR Life Sciences company, appointed David Stewart SVP and Site Head of KBI’s mammalian cGMP manufacturing facility in Durham, NC.

A successful operational leader in the contract development and manufacturing organization (CDMO) industry, Stewart has more than two decades of biotech leadership experience and a proven record of delivering best-in-class supply for patients. As an expert in leading diverse, multi-disciplinary teams, he will oversee all operations at the Patriot Park location, driving deliverables for KBI’s global biopharmaceutical clients.

Stewart brings to KBI more than 20 years of insight gained from leadership roles at Genentech, Biogen, and, most recently, Fujifilm Diosynth Biotechnologies. His expertise includes project execution, product supply, operational readiness, process engineering, product technical transfer, lab operations, automation engineering, and technical validation.
